Jan Czekanowski - Racial Classification

Racial Classification

Czekanowski classified Europe into four pure races. The four pure races were the Nordic, Ibero-Insular, Lapponoid and Armenoid. The Lapponoid included the central and eastern Europeans along Europe longitudely as well as the Sami people of Northern Europe.

Czekanowski classified six subraces in Europe which were mixed types of the pure races. The six mixed racial subraces were: the Northwestern (Nordic and Ibero-Insular), the Subnordic (Nordic and Lapponoid), Alpine (Lapponoid and Armenoid), the Littoral (Ibero-Insular and Armenoid), Pile Dwelling (Ibero-Insular and Lapponoid) and the Dinaric (Nordic and Armenoid). The Pile Dwelling subrace lived around the Swiss lakes.

Pure Races
  1. α =Nordic race
  2. ε =Ibero-Insular race
  3. λ =Lapponoid race
  4. χ =Armenoid race
Mixed Types
  1. ι =Northwestern mixed type
  2. γ =Subnordic mixed type
  3. ω =Alpine mixed type
  4. ρ =Littoral mixed type
  5. β =Pile Dwelling mixed type
  6. δ =Dinaric mixed type
